PP/云母复合材料的增容效果及其界面结构 被引量:10

Compatibilization and Interfacial Structure of PP/Mica Composite
在线阅读 下载PDF
导出
摘要 制备和研究了 80目、40 0目和 12 5 0目三种不同粒径的云母增强PP复合材料。结果显示 ,云母可普遍提高PP的强度、模量和室温韧性 ,其中弯曲性能增幅尤甚 ,但材料断裂伸长率下降。减小云母粒径 ,材料韧性上升而刚性下降。PP -g MAH可强化PP与云母两相的界面结合 ,使界面过渡层变厚 ,从而普遍提高各项性能。 s PP/mica composite that consists of three different sizes mica of 80, 400 and 1250 mesh were prepared and studied.The tensile and flexural strength and modulus and toughness at room temperature increased when PP was filled with mica,among which the improvement of flexural properties was best,but the elongation at break of the PP/mica descended.When the size of mica reduced,the toughness of PP/mica composite increased and the rigidity descended.It was found that because of adding PP-g-MAH,the interface compatibility between PP and mica and the interfacial layer were improved,as a result the properties of PP/mica composite were improved.
